Tonight at 10:00 PM ET, Sinner to Saint: Anthony Hargrove’s Super Bowl Journey chronicles the life of Saints DE Anthony Hargrove, who after being kicked out of the NFL following multiple failed drug tests, confronts his dark past and substance abuse issues to receive a second chance with the New Orleans Saints that materialized into a Super Bowl championship. Told in Hargrove’s own words, the compelling one-hour NFL Network-produced documentary also features interviews with Saints head coach Sean Payton, general manager Mickey Loomis, Rams RB Steven Jackson and numerous members of Hargrove’s support team including therapists, counselors and family members.

Wednesday also features more Saints-related programming with the premiere of America’s Game: 2009 New Orleans Saints at 9:00 PM ET. Narrated by Academy Award-nominated actor Brad Pitt, the latest episode in the America’s Game series chronicles the story of the Saints’ historic Super Bowl win through the words of head coach Sean Payton, quarterback Drew Brees and linebacker Jonathan Vilma.
